Guitar enthusiasts will definitely know of the limited edition Firebird X which has purportedly being sold out already, and Gibson (the Firebird X’s manufacturer) certainly isn’t going to rest on their laurels, but will instead look towards the future by announcing an upcoming catalogue of guitars which will feature its Pure-Analog Engine that is capable of being opened up for 3rd party application development. This will definitely make you look at an electric guitar differently the next time around, since you can then download applications which will work with any guitar using the Gibson standard, and the Firebird X will definitely be included. Of course, only an authorized store is the place where vendors can sell their verified compliant applications, where revenue will be shared for everyone’s mutual benefit.
